Transaction 586fbebb6fc91e6bb2235998f7ce83a4fc9632d0bf66215d9fbdea2e46037b38
1 Input
1 Output
-
586fbebb6fc91e6bb2235998f7ce83a4fc9632d0bf66215d9fbdea2e46037b38:0
- value
- 642521
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 005853df124ae012cc6cee2284d90c7ccc96807f OP_EQUALVERIFY OP_CHECKSIG
- address
- 112pp7RkVpn5ar43frwGpgJ7EZeG7xQiWV